The Surprising Power of Deep Document Reading

In a groundbreaking live experiment, several leading AI models faced a simulated week of crises at a small software business. Every decision—crisis responses, manipulations, negotiations—was tracked and auditable. The goal? See which AI truly understood the company’s internal files, not just the surface-level customer interactions.

Deep Reading Wins the Deal

All four models identified every crisis and refused manipulation attempts, demonstrating a solid grasp of the company’s core issues. But only two models actually sealed the deal, earning their €55,000 commission. Their secret? They had found and understood a critical, buried fact—two document references deep in the company’s own files—that convinced the client to sign at full price.

The Hidden Data That Made the Difference

This buried fact was not visible in the company’s public-facing customer event logs; it was tucked away in internal documents. The models that read these files thoroughly and incorporated that information into their pitch were the ones that won. In contrast, models that skipped deep document analysis left the deal on the table, leaving revenue on the line.

Trust and Integrity Under Pressure

Beyond understanding internal data, the experiment tested AI resistance to social engineering—fake CEO messages and reporter tricks designed to manipulate decision-making. All models correctly refused these attempts, thanks to built-in reasoning that treated suspicious requests as potential impersonation or approval-bypass attempts. This resilience is crucial for securing trustworthy AI in real-world business operations.

Who Came Out on Top?

  • gpt-5.6-sol scored a 95 and convincingly found the buried fact, closing the deal at full price.
  • Kimi K3, a newcomer, scored 93 and demonstrated the cleanest discipline, also sealing the deal.
  • Sonnet 5 and Sonnet 4.8 followed, with scores of 88 and 77 respectively, but left revenue on the table by not fully reading or acting on internal data.
